Analysis

Sweden recorded 39,876 Index, 2020=100 for economic accounts for agriculture - agricultural income indicators in 2025.

Compared with earlier readings it is up 16.1% on the previous year and up 41.3% over ten years.

Over the whole period, economic accounts for agriculture - agricultural income indicators in Sweden peaked at 43,488 Index, 2020=100 in 2022 and was at its lowest, 13,959 Index, 2020=100, in 1992.

That places Sweden 8th out of 40 countries with data for 2025, putting it in the top quarter.

The long-run direction has been consistently rising across the 51 years of available data.
